Artisanal Moroccan Rugs: A Legacy of Style

Moroccan rugs weave a rich history of artistry and tradition. Each rug is a testament to the skilled hands held by Berber artisans who meticulously create vibrant designs using time-honored dyes and passed-down techniques. These rugs, often displaying intricate patterns and rich hues, are not merely floor coverings but rather pieces of art.

  • The intricate designs often represent the nomadic life of the Moroccan people.
  • From the traditional Beni Ourain rugs with their soft textures to the vibrant Boujari rugs known for their bold floral patterns, there is a Moroccan rug to suit every style.

The Art about Berber Weaving: Authentic Moroccan Rugs

Berber rugs, recognized for their stunning patterns, are a vibrant testament to the time-honored craft of Berber weaving. For generations, nomadic Berber tribes throughout Morocco have created these rugs, each one a unique piece of art. The techniques involves skillfully knotting fiber threads on a wooden loom, resulting in dense rugs where are both beautiful.

Every Berber rug tells a moroccan carpet story, often illustrating the weaver's cultural heritage. The shades used vary depending on the region and customs, creating a spectrum of vibrant hues that capture the essence of Moroccan life.

Amongst intricate geometric motifs to representational animal shapes, Berber rugs offer a window into the rich history and artistic heritage of Morocco.

They are not simply mats but works of art that contain the wisdom passed down through families.
